How many cups is 178 grams when converted to cups? Since a gram measures weight and a cup measures volume, the cup amount hinges on the ingredient’s density. For water, 178 grams equals approximately 0.7524 cups. For all-purpose flour, the volume is closer to 1.424 cups, and for granulated sugar, approximately 0.89 cups.

Measuring 178 Grams Without a Kitchen Scale
Don’t have a scale handy? It’s still possible to estimate 178 grams using common kitchen tools — just remember the result will be a volume estimate, and accuracy depends heavily on the ingredient.
Use Measuring Cups for Liquids
For water, milk, and other liquids with density close to 1 g/mL, you can measure directly. 178 grams of water ≈ 0.7524 US cups ≈ 178 mL. Most glass liquid-measuring cups have mL markings that make this easy.
Use Tablespoons and Teaspoons for Small Amounts
For dry powders like flour, sugar, or salt, tablespoons can replace a scale if you’re careful to level off each spoonful with a flat edge. As a baseline (for water): 178 grams ≈ 12.038 tablespoons ≈ 36.11 teaspoons.
Volume-First Reference (Ingredient-Specific)
- Flour: Spoon flour into the cup, then level — don’t scoop with the cup (that compresses and adds ~25% weight). 178 g of AP flour ≈ 1.424 cups.
- Granulated sugar: Sugar packs predictably, so cup measurements stay close to accurate. 178 g ≈ 0.89 cups.
- Brown sugar: Pack firmly into the cup. 178 g packed ≈ 0.8091 cups.
- Butter: Use the wrapper markings (in the US, 1 stick = 113 g = ½ cup). 178 g ≈ 0.7841 cups.

The Gram — A Universal Weight
The Cup — A Familiar Volume
US Customary Cup
236.588 mL. Used in nearly all American recipes and on US nutrition labels.
US Legal Cup
240 mL. Defined by FDA for nutrition labeling. Slightly larger than the customary cup.
Metric Cup
Exactly 250 mL. Standard in Canada, Australia, New Zealand, and many European countries.
UK Imperial Cup
284.131 mL (½ imperial pint). Mostly historical now — modern UK recipes typically use weight or mL.
